Few questions Bokks,

1. Is the trellis made of wood or metal and painted?
2. The roofing on the lower level are removed? for what reason?

Suggetions:

1. The horizontal lines/wood on the upper part of the gate, better make it thinner it closes the view.
2. Stone treatment is fine but I think sa upper level pwede wala na otherwise extend it up to the ceiling and make it wider end to end of the windows sill.
3. Lamp posts should stay.
